Ralph Thompson Former Executive Secretary General Conference of Seventh-day Adventists Silver Spring, Maryland, USA About the Book This volume emerged out of an almost fatal experience on the job. The prologue relates vivid details of an air-ambulance trip from the intensive-care unit at the Governor Juan Luis Hospital, St. Croix, Virgin Islands, to Miami Beach, Florida, as the author sought the expertise of an electro-physiologist. Looking back at her entire life's experience, the author concluded that she had much to share with fellow travelers. The story takes the reader from Trinidad and Tobago in the southern Caribbean, through Barbados, St. Lucia, Dominica, and Antigua, to the U.S. Virgin Islands, where the author and her husband now reside. The book is filled with intrigue, happy times and heartaches, goals achieved and disappointments, near death encounters and true love. As the author has experienced God's care throughout her adventurous life, she can only be very grateful, and this book expresses her appreciation to God and all whose lives touched hers in positive ways.
